Disable the Google Assistant Home Button

The steps are slightly different on stock Android devices and those running other custom skins.

On Stock Android (Google Pixel, Motorola, and LG)

To turn it off on stock Android devices, you must turn off the Assist app in the settings. Here are the steps:

Step 1: Open deviceSettingsand go toApps/Application Manager,depending on the option available on your device.

Step 2:Tap onDefault apps, followed byAssist & voice input.

Step 3: Tap onAssist app. On the next screen, you will see a list of apps with Google selected as the assist app. ChooseNoneto disable Assistant on the home button.

That’s it. You have successfully disabled the Google Assistant home button on your device. If you are not running on stock Android but on Samsung, continue reading.

On Samsung Devices

Step 1:OpenSettingsand go toApps.

Step 2:SelectDefault appsfrom the menu. On the next screen, tap on theDigital assistant app.

Step 3:Tap on theDigital assistant appagain > chooseNoneto disable the Google Assistant.

There you go. Google Assistant home button disabled. If you are on Xiaomi, continue reading.

On MIUI Devices

For Xiaomi’s MIUI-running phones, the option is present under the gestures. Here are the steps:

Step 1:OpenSettingsand go toAdditional settings.

Step 2:Tap theButton and gesture shortcuts.

Step 3: Tap onLaunch Google Assistant. On the next screen, selectNoneto remove it from the home screen.

On OnePlus Devices

Step 1:OpenSettingsand go toApps.

Step 2:Tap onDefault apps, followed byDigital assistant app.

Step 3:Tap on theDefault digital assistant appoption and chooseNone.

That’s about it. You have removed the Google Assistant home button on the OnePlus device.
